He told The Monitor that the incident took place on Saturday at around 10:05pm at Sefalana Shoppers, Old Mall in Palapye Central. According to Oketsang, the thieves used the rooftop to gain entry into the shop.

They broke in and stole 200 packets of Peter Stuyvesant cigarettes, 50 okapi knives, 80 one-litre yoghurts, and two 1kg sausages, he added.

He said: “Other items amount to P7,845 which gives a total of P27,845 for all the stolen goods.” Oketsang indicated that the suspects wanted to blast the office to gain access to the safe box but failed and decided to steal the above-mentioned goods. He said that the suspects are still at large and pleaded with the community to help them with information relating to the matter.

“This is a massive drawback to the owners of the business, therefore if you see anyone selling the above-mentioned goods in large and small amounts without proof of purchase please contact us,” he said.
